Handover note — from Priya Aldenham to Marcus Fells. The Quillbrook pilot's churn position needs your early attention: attrition sits at 12.3%, above the 9% tolerance we set, with most losses in the Eastmoor branches during weeks two to five. Root-cause work by the retention team points to unclear fee schedules. Branch managers have interim guidance already. The confidential plan you should socialise carefully appears directly below.

confidential, kagup-bafog: Fraaxax Group is in early talks to buy Soroxox Group for about $343.8 million. The Olidor launch date is June 14, and nothing goes to the press before then. Legal wants the Aldmirek Logistics term sheet signed before July 23.

Welcome aboard! One tool you'll use daily is `tailwrangler`, our internal CLI for streaming logs from the Perchline clusters. Install it via the internal package feed, then run `tailwrangler init` to set up your profile. Most folks alias it to `tw` — saves typing.

First time in, it'll generate a local vault for cached credentials. If you ever reinstall or switch laptops, you'll need the recovery passphrase to unlock that vault. Keep it somewhere safe. Your recovery passphrase is below.

recovery phrase for bawep-kawef: oliath-casdor

Handover — Hallwright Audio Guide, v3.2 release

For the release manager: I've frozen the Hallwright museum audio-guide branch; all narration assets for the Ellsmere Gallery wing are uploaded and verified. Two caveats: the offline-map bundle must be signed before publishing, and the staging vault auto-locked yesterday, so you'll need to reopen it to sign. The vault prompts for a recovery passphrase at unlock, and it is noted directly below.

recovery phrase for fawif-tajeg: norael-aldmir-casir-brivan-ulaion

Handover — Quillrow cache incident

Stale-cache postmortem wrapped today. Root cause: the Lanternfish service kept serving expired catalog entries because the invalidation hook fired before the write committed. Fix shipped; TTLs shortened and the hook now runs post-commit. Watch the eviction-lag dashboard for the next 48h — anything over 30s, page me. Marta reviewed the patch; no rollback expected. If you need to redeploy, don't guess at settings. The exact values Lanternfish must run with are listed below.

config for hahaf-kafof:
[wenys]
host = wenys.torvahq.corp
user = wenys_svc
database = wenys_prod